Description
- With this model your students make base pairs and combine them to make a model of the DNA double helix.
- Learn about the importance of: complementary base pairing, nucleotide structure, double-helix shape, 5' and 3' ends, antiparallel strands, sugar-phosphate backbone, purines and pyrimidines and DNA sequence.
- Resource for advanced or introductory level lessons.
- You can make as long a DNA model as you like with any sequence you wish you use.
- Takes about 20 minutes to make a 12 base pair model.
- Origami Organelles are downloadable paper models that you print and make as many times as you like. When you purchase a model, provide an email address for the PDF to be emailed to and then you are licensed for unlimited use on a single site or campus.
- Dimensions: DNA strand: 43 cm (17 in.) long and 10 cm (4 in.) wide
- Download includes: instructions, color and mono model templates and PowerPoint file
- All you need: paper, scissors and tape
